Cons:

The sign lights on the battery are complicated and not discussed anywhere in the instruction book or on the business’s site. The battery was dead when I got it, so I put it on to charge. 3 hours later on, I had to chat in to the producer to ask what one traffic signal and 3 thumbs-ups indicated. There was likewise a light on the battery charger that turned from red to green and then remained on when it was unplugged. So complicated. FWIW, one traffic signal and 3 thumbs-ups means it is completely charged, but the cuatomer service agent who I chatted with had to go check, they didn’t know for sure.

The bike seat is very uncomfortable and tilts back. I can change it back, but no matter what, when I sit on it, the back decreases, and the front shows up. I attempted tightening up the bolts on both sides of the seat, however that didn’t solve the issue since that’s not what is loose. There are two bars that are clamped in by metal tubes, and they are too loose. No quantity of changing will correct it. Due to the fact that the battery sits beneath it, I’m unwilling to buy a replacement seat. The seat has a trigger that makes it tilt up so the battery can be gotten rid of.
Plus, I’m great buying devices for my new bike, however I shouldn’t need to buy replacement parts for malfunctioning part of my brand new bike. It should just work.

The guideline and website don’t state anywhere how to turn the power on. I found out the “on” setting on the battery, however nowhere in the directions does it state “press the M button on the digital display screen to turn it on.” (Why M? What does M mean??).

I was anticipating to have to tighten bolts on the parts I had to set up, but the fork has a sticker that says the bolt was tightened mechanically in the factory. As I was taking a sharp turn, the front tire turned to one side so the handlebars were in an entirely various instructions than the fork.
